55-65.Berger &
Bernardo's
(1989)
reference
priors and
Tibshirani
(1989) priors
are derived
for
distributions
in Bar-Lev &
Reiser's
(1982)
two-parameter
exponential
family when
either the
location or
the scale
parameter is
of interest.
The reference
prior is shown
to be a
Tibshirani
prior.
Furthermore,
conditions
under which a
Tibshirani
prior is a
higher-order
matching prior
are
investigated.
When both the
parameters are
of interest,
it is also
shown that the
reference
prior agrees
with the prior
matching the
posterior and
frequentist
expansions
based on the
signed square
root of
log-likelihood
ratio. The
normal,
inverse
Gaussian, and
gamma
distributions
are used to
illustrate the
results.

900-919.Networ
k access
control
mechanisms
constitute an
increasingly
needed
service, when
communications
are becoming
more and more
ubiquitous
thanks to some
technologies
such as
wireless
networks or
Mobile IP.
This paper
presents a
particular
scenario where
access rules
are based not
only on the
identity of
the different
users but also
on
authorization
data related
to those
users. In
order to
accomplish
this general
goal, it will
be necessary
to add to the
traditional
system-specifi
c services for
authentication
and
authorization,
and also some
entities able
to manage the
information
related to
identity,
roles and
permissions.
Network access
will be based
on the 802.1X
framework and
the
Authentication
,
Authorization,
and Accounting
(AAA)
architecture,
as they
constitute the
basis for most
of the
existing
proposals for
limiting the
access to a
restricted
network. These
proposals will
be extended
making use of
an
authorization
infrastructure
based on SAML
statements,
the RBAC
model, and
XACML as the
main language
for expressing
authorization
policies. The
solution that
we present in
this paper is
a consequence
of an
exhaustive and
non-trivial
analysis of
the different
mechanisms
that could be
used to
provide this
kind of
service. As we
will see, the
correct
integration of
these
different
mechanisms
leads to the
definition of
a scalable and
versatile
network access
control system
which conforms
to the
guidelines
outlined by
the AAA
initiative.Gab

128-135.Since
early 2007 a
new version of
the
Anisotropic
Analytical
Algorithm
(AAA) for
photon dose
calculations
was released
by Varian
Medical
Systems for
clinical usage
on Elekta
linacs and
also, with
some
restrictions,
for Siemens
linacs. Basic
validation
studies were
performed and
reported for
three beams:
4,6 and 15 MV
for an Elekta
Synergy, 6 and
15 MV for a
Siemens Primus
and, as a
reference, for
6 and 15 MV
from a Varian
Clinac
2100C/D.
Generally AAA
calculations
reproduced
well measured
data and small
deviations
were observed
for open and
wedged fields.
PDD curves
showed in
average
differences
between
calculation
and
measurement
smaller than
1% or 1.2 mm
for Elekta
beams, 1% or
1.8 mm for
Siemens beams
and 1% or 1 mm
for Varian
beams.
Profiles in
the flattened
region matched
measurements
with
deviations
smaller than
1% for Elekta
and Varian
beams, 2% for
Siemens.
Percentage
differences in
Output Factors
were observed
as small as 1%
in
average.Luca
